Abstract:
Runner formation in Chlorophytum comosum 'Vitattum' can be controlled by photoperiod.
Daylengths ≤12 hours reduced the time required for visible runner formation from 34 weeks (18 hour daylength) to 9 weeks.
Three weeks of 8 hour daylengths was the minimum number of short days required to reduce the days to visible runner formation.
